我需要将SQL Server的以下函数转换为MySQL。我是MySQL的新手。需要帮助。此函数根据日期返回生成的Id:-S1或S2 ..S5 :字母S后跟从星期一开始的月份中的周数-0X两位数的月份-15两位数的年份2015/06/01 to 2015/06/07 is S106152015/06/29 to 2015/
我正在创建一个查询,它应该与我在MsSQL中使用的DataTable相匹配。这是我第一次使用MsSQL,所以我正在尝试从我的MySQL中找出等价的MsSQL查询。我进行了一个自定义查询,它将处理MySQL to MsSQL中的LIMIT函数(希望如此)。我在我的datatable中使用了以下查询: SELECT top 20 CAST(DATEPART(YEAR,[Deliver
我有一个"datetime“类型的列,值类似于2009-10-20 10:00:00SELECT * FROM WHERE datetime= '2009-10-20' 下面是最好的方法吗?datetime BETWEEN('2009-10-20 00:00:00' AND '2009-10-20 23:59:59')但是,这将
我写了一个查询,以了解上周(星期一至星期日)售出的产品的数量。但是查询在GETDATE()函数中给出了一个错误。下面可以看到我从SQL中得到的错误。#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L serverversion for the right syntax to use near 'GETDATE()))AND a.added_date < D
我尝试使用Server来选择当前月份的数据,但它没有得到任何结果。当我在SQL中运行相同的代码时,它得到了原来的结果。我查询的错误是什么?我想在Server中运行这个查询。EnrolledID, Date, Time WHERE Date LIKE '2019-08%'Server数据库日期中的日期与该